Caught in the net: Fishing in foreign waters

KARACHI: The wrinkles on his forehead appeared deeper, each time Chunni Laal, with squinting eyes, peeked out of the paramilitary truck. It had been a few hours since the vehicle had arrived at the courtyard of city courts. Laal sat idly, crouched, mumbling some prayers. So did 26 others.

Twenty-seven Indian fishermen were brought to the city courts on Monday by the Docks police. They looked grim as a police guard told them that they were to be presented before the judge for breaching into Pakistani territory in open waters.
